When talking about the Foundation's directive, everyone knows SCP means "Secure, Contain, Protect." But in the context of the Foundation's name, its full name is the Special Containment Procedures Foundation. So when speaking of SCPs, would their full names be "Special Containment Procedure Number 173" or "Secure, Contain, Protect 173"?

Secure, Contain, and Protect: SCP Tabletop RPG is now available for the brave. Following a successful Kickstarter, SCP The Tabletop RPG has now gone on general release. The early reviews give it 5/5 stars on DriveThruRPG. In the game, characters are members of The Foundation and have the mission to Secure, Contain and Protect the various.

The SCP Foundation is a secretive organization that contains anomalous or supernatural items and entities away from the eyes of the public. SCP stands for Secure, Contain, Protect. Little is known about the Foundation's origins, with some sources claiming dates as far back as 1500 BC; however, most sources, including the Foundation's earliest reliable data, dates to around the mid-1800s. Security Department staff have a keycard correlating to their level of access in the facility. They carry an M4 Assault Rifle with a 30-round magazine, along with a standard radio which allows them to communicate with all foundation personnel. Security Department personnel can also purchase weapons from gear shops at the Class-D Cells.

SCP-1762-2 is the collective term applied to the beings that emerge from SCP-1762-1. All instances of SCP-1762-2 bear resemblance to various types of dragons, in both Eastern and Western depictions, albeit in forms similar to that of origami models. Analysis of SCP-1762-2 reveals that they are composed of Kami paper.
